Fiddler抓包工具--必须知道的几个用法

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/zhaileilei1/article/details/86489500

我们以plus.m.jd.com 为例

1.打开fiddler,浏览器随便打开页面,左侧就会显示访问的页面以及请求地址

2.拦截请求修改返回值

假设现在我们要拦截以下红色框标记请求,在黑色框输入 bpafter+空格+请求,回车

再次访问页面,如果请求出现红色盾牌表示拦截成功。

点击右侧 Inspectors,下面的TextView可修改返回值,修改后,点击绿色按钮,Run to complited继续执行

 

3.AutoResponder,修改线上文件到本地,如果没有线上文件,先保存,如果有,忽略此步

然后打开右侧 AutoResponder,选中替换的文件,点击ADD Rules,替换成本地文件选择 find a file

如果要替换一个文件夹下的多个文件到本地,可选择以下方式

和选择一个文件操作相同,只是把前面的 EXACT变为 REGEX

4.过滤不需要的请求

如果请求过多,很多无关请求会一直刷fiddler,所以我们过滤掉不相关请求

 点击右侧 filters,填入需要的 地址,以分号隔开,如果没生效,点击右侧 change not yet saved。然后,fiddler抓到的请求会大大减少不相干请求

 5.抓https请求

目前我们是抓不到https请求的,因为没有证书,首先下载证书 FiddlerCertMaker ,然后在fiddler中依次点击 Tools-options-https

此时访问https请求被成功获取。

5.手机连接fiddler,首先fiddler勾选以下选项

在同一个网络下,打开手机,以安卓为例

连接网络,设置代理为手动:192.168.191.1,端口 8888

打开网页,输入地址:192.168.191.1:8888 安装证书

打开手机设置-其他设置-安全与隐私-从存储设备安装证书-找到刚才下载的证书

然后访问即可

 最后,感谢这位博主:http://www.hangge.com/blog/cache/detail_1697.html

猜你喜欢

转载自blog.csdn.net/zhaileilei1/article/details/86489500
今日推荐